To find the Least Common Multiple (LCM) of 216 and 8, we first need to factorize both numbers. 216 = 2^3 * 3^3 and 8 = 2^3. The LCM is the product of the highest power of each prime factor that appears in the factorization of the two numbers. Therefore, the LCM of 216 and 8 is 2^3 * 3^3 = 216.

To determine how many times 72 goes into 216, you would divide 216 by 72. The result is 3, which means that 72 goes into 216 three times without any remainder. This is because 72 multiplied by 3 equals 216.

216 can be expressed as the product of its prime factors: 2^3 x 3^3. In other words, 2 cubed multiplied by 3 cubed equals 216. This can also be written as 6^3, as 6 is the cube root of 216. So, 216 is equal to 2^3 x 3^3, or 6^3.
